Attach small jar lids underneath a cabinet, fill the jars with spices and then screw them to their lids. All your spices will be right where you need them and the new storage adds some charm and interest to your kitchen.

Organize pot, pan and Tupperware lids with a magazine rack attached to the inside of a kitchen cabinet door. Do this in a few cabinets for ultimate organization!
Lazy Susan in the Fridge
Add a lazy susan to a shelf in your fridge so all you have to do is spin it around to find bottles, juice, condiments and other items you need to access regularly. Tissue Box turned Bag Keeper
Recycle that empty tissue box by using it to contain all those plastic grocery bags you’re saving. This makes grabbing a bag easy and makes more room for storing other things in your closet.
DIY Dishtowel Hangers
To keep your dishtowels from slipping off your oven or cupboard handles, loop a small piece of ribbon through the handle. Then, tie each end to the ends of a binder clip and clip the towel so it stays put.
Easy Recipe Holder
Stop straining to read those recipes! Hang a small hanger, with clips, on a cupboard handle and clip your recipe to it. The instructions will be at eye level so you can read your recipe at a glance while cooking.
